I'm a kind of newbie with VirtualBox and now I've faced a weird problem. I have a Ubuntu 10.10 as a host operating system and Windows XP Pro as a guest system. Everything works just fine, but some softwares needs to SP2 be installed to XP. So, after SP2 installation, system wants to reboot, that's fine. But now VirtualBox cannot boot XP up and it try to reboot it forever. XP boot go further until XP start-up screen appears (XP logo and a running bar) but after a few seconds it disappoears and VirtualBox reboot again. Any ideas?
